Covid tests mandatory at picnic spots in and around Jamshedpur

PINAKI MAJUMDAR

Jamshedpur, Dec 25: The East Singhbhum district administration on Saturday issued orders for Covid tests at picnic spots in and around Jamshedpur.

Picnickers will have to undergo Covid tests – RAT and RT- PCR – at Dimna Lake, Jubilee Park and other picnic spots, which draws huge footfall.

“Picnic is not prohibited at Dimna Lake and other places, but picnickers must adhere to Covid norms like wearing masks and social distancing,” said a health department official.

He further said that Covid test is made mandatory in picnic spots due to the possible threat of a third wave caused by Omicron, a new mutant of the novel coronavirus.

Currently, over 1,000 people visit Dimna Lake every day. But the yearend crowd is expected to swell to thousands, posing a challenge for the police administration.

A senior police officer said they will start large-scale Covid testing at the lake as a strategy to diffuse numbers.

“We cannot prevent people from picnicking at Dimna lake and other picnic spots. But, at the same time, we have to ensure that those coming must adhere to Covid norms.  As many people are reluctant to get tested, this might discourage them to throng the spot,” he added.
